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Branchton to Burton-on-Trent start from as little as £25.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Branchton to Burton-on-Trent start from £122.70 one way, or £175.40 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Branchton to Burton-on-Trent are available for £126.20 one way, or £252.40 return

Facilities and Amenities

Branchton Station may not boast an extensive array of amenities, but it offers the essentials for a convenient journey. Unfortunately, there is no ticket office or machine to collect tickets, so it would be wise to secure your tickets in advance from online sources. However, the station provides an induction loop for the hearing-impaired and a smartcard validator which enhances the travel experience with modern conveniences.

Accessibility is a priority at Branchton with step-free access available on parts of the station, categorized as a B2 station. There is crucial advice concerning the stepping distance when boarding or alighting trains, so vigilance is recommended. CCTV ensures a level of security, although the absence of staff assistance means planning is crucial, particularly for those requiring additional support.

The station offers a basic seating area for passengers awaiting their trains but doesn’t feature toilets, refreshment facilities, or cash services. Parking is a breeze with complimentary parking available 24/7 in a lot that accommodates 16 vehicles, including a dedicated accessible space.

Onward Travel Options

Branchton provides several ways to continue your journey once you arrive at the station. For seamless integration with road transport, local buses can be caught just outside the station on Inverkip Road, ensuring connectivity to broader areas. Visit Travel Line Scotland for detailed bus services or dial their 24-hour line at 0871 200 22 33. If you prefer the ease of private transportation, information about available taxis can be accessed via traintaxi.co.uk.

Essential Facilities and Services

Burton-on-Trent station is especially equipped to handle ticketing needs efficiently. Its ticket office is open throughout the week, with operating hours from early morning at 6:10 AM till evening. For those buying tickets online or via mobile, ticket machines are available, alongside accessible ticket machines to ensure convenience for all passengers. Furthermore, the station is equipped with an induction loop to assist those with hearing impairments, showcasing its commitment to accessibility.

The station is staffed from morning until late at night on weekdays and Saturdays, offering customer assistance at various points across the site. Information displays for departures and arrivals are kept up to date, and help points are strategically placed for ease of access. While most facilities are comprehensive, the amenity for luggage storage is not present; however, they do coordinate with the EMR lost property office in Nottingham should any items be misplaced.

For those needing to freshen up before their journey, the presence of toilets, including accessible facilities and baby changing stations, on Platform 2 provides added convenience. With waiting rooms available during ticket office hours and an ample seating area, comfort is never compromised.

Connectivity and Transport Links

Beyond the rail network, Burton-on-Trent station connects passengers to alternative transport services. Nearby, taxis can be hailed for direct routes to your destination, with reliable local services available through contacts such as Station Taxis and New Street Taxis. Bus services are also accessible, and detailed onward travel information can be found online, helping plan your post-arrival journey with ease. If alternative transport is required due to service disruptions, a rail replacement service is conveniently located right outside the station.

Seamless Access and Parking

In terms of accessibility, the station ensures step-free access across its platforms, complemented by tactile paving for visually impaired passengers. Although no ticket barriers are present, the facility accommodates six accessible parking spaces, adhering to various mobility needs. With a comprehensive car park open 24/7, managed by East Midlands Railway, parking fees are structured to offer flexibility—even including special weekend rates.
